On Sunday afternoon, the ultimate day of Celebration, Ashley Eckstein moderated an entertaining, and at occasions unexpectedly heartfelt, panel that includes dialog amongst Anthony Daniels, Ahmed Finest, and Alan Tudyk. Collectively, the 4 of them represented the completely different eras of Star Wars: the Authentic Trilogy, Prequel Trilogy, The Clone Wars, and the Kathleen Kennedy five-film slate. Regardless of almost forty years between the filming of A New Hope and Rogue One, the 4 shared many frequent experiences and feelings from their involvement in Star Wars.

They started the panel by objecting – largely however not fully in jest – to the label “sidekicks” for his or her respective characters. Eckstein acknowledged that Ahsoka did begin out as a little bit of a snippy sidekick earlier than taking over a extra central thematic function in The Clone Wars and in the end incomes her personal live-action collection. Daniels reminded the viewers that C-3PO has extra dialogue in A New Hope than another character, whereas Finest good-naturedly apologized for Jar Jar’s important second in inadvertently facilitating Palpatine’s dictatorial rise.

Daniels and Finest shared attention-grabbing and prolonged anecdotes about how that they had been initially employed for the bodily efficiency of their characters however not the vocal efficiency, till George Lucas later latched onto their work in character throughout manufacturing. Finest additionally described in depth the shared inspirations with Lucas for his physicality as Jar Jar, together with Jackie Chan, Buster Keaton, and Charlie Chaplin. Eckstein agreed that Lucas was “actually massive on homework” in offering movies to observe and be impressed by throughout The Clone Wars.

Notably, all three onscreen actors underscored the significance of utilizing human actors as the muse for non-human characters in costumes (like Threepio or many Star Wars aliens) or computer-generated or computer-enhanced characters (like Jar Jar and K2-SO). Constructing on his earlier feedback about changing into the voice of Threepio, Daniels insisted {that a} single actor doing the physique and voice will ship one of the best efficiency. He recalled that in A New Hope, the cantina aliens initially had been deliberate to be actors, however the costumes have been positioned on extras to save cash: “A rubber head on an actor is a personality. A rubber head on an additional is simply there,” he lamented. Tudyk agreed on the significance of human performers, noting that, like Threepio, K2 has a static face, which requires characterization to be delivered by way of vocals and motion. Tudyk defined that his theater background, which equally depends extra on voice and motion than facial features, actually helped in creating K2-SO. Finest now directs motion-capture work for a variety of initiatives, and he emphasised {that a} mo-cap performer isn’t just a stand-in for a efficiency to be added digitally later, however moderately should embody the character to supply a compelling groundwork for the following digital results.

Finest closed the panel by reminding the assembled followers that the actors are followers too, that Star Wars is “deeply private to each single one in every of us,” and that they genuinely do care what the followers suppose and need them to take pleasure in every new Star Wars journey.
